Trans-Matic's large eyelet press and die set transfer press technology provides the capability to draw components to an overall length of 7” (177mm) and to accommodate raw material thickness up to .150” (3.81mm).
Trans-Matic's large press capability begins with several Waterbury Farrel presses in the 105 ton (95 tonne) to 300 ton (272 tonne) size. Our die set transfer press capabilities begin with 400 ton (363 tonne) Aida and Minster presses and go up to 600 tons (544 tonne).

In September 2005, Trans-Matic acquired a 105 ton, 16 station, quick die change, eyelet press capable of producing parts requiring a 5½ inch blank and up to 5 inches in overall length. This fact is complimented by the tooling flexibility provided by the two quick change die-sets. This technology allows us to significantly reduce our set-up times between manufacturing orders and allows smaller production run quantities. These factors are critical to achieving our lean manufacturing objectives.
